Where It Shines: From Tote Bags to Nursery Pillows

I tested Mama PNG Mom Life Sublimation Design across three actual projects: a cotton canvas tote bag, a midweight French terry sweatshirt, and a 100% cotton pillow cover for a local baby boutique. On the tote, the floral elements translated beautifully into satin-stitched petals—soft, dimensional, and durable after washing. On the sweatshirt, the lettering held crispness without excessive stitch density, and the overall scale (roughly 4.5" wide) sat comfortably above the left chest. For the pillow cover, I used a light tear-away stabilizer and medium-weight cutaway underneath—just enough to keep the fill stitches smooth on the slightly napped fabric.

This isn’t a one-trick design. It works as a standalone embroidered patch, scales well for a small-apron corner, and holds up in printable mockups for Etsy listings. As a craft business owner, I appreciate how easily it fits into cohesive collections—pair it with minimalist birth announcements or coordinating kitchen towels, and you’ve got a mini “mom life” line that feels curated, not cluttered.

Where to Pause—and Why

That said, Mama PNG Mom Life Sublimation Design asks for thoughtful placement. On thin or stretchy fabrics like jersey baby onesies, I’d recommend testing first: the floral outlines rely on clean satin stitch edges, and even slight fabric distortion can blur those delicate curves. Dark fabrics? Absolutely workable—but only if your thread colors contrast strongly. I ran a quick black-and-white mockup and realized the inner flourishes fade slightly on charcoal unless you boost stitch definition with a contrasting underlay.

It’s also not ideal for very small hoop sizes (under 3") or curved surfaces like structured caps. The floral swirls and letter spacing need breathing room. And while it’s lovely on tea towels and aprons, avoid placing it near high-friction zones—like the bottom hem of a toddler’s shirt—where dense fill areas might wear faster over time.
